Why Dubai? The Allure of the Emirates
Before diving into the "how," it's crucial to understand the "why." Dubai offers a unique proposition for expatriates:
Tax-Free Income: The most famous draw. There is currently no personal income tax on salaries in the UAE. This means your gross salary is essentially your net take-home pay, allowing for significant savings and a high disposable income.
Lucrative Compensation Packages: Many roles, especially mid-to-senior level positions, come with attractive benefits beyond the base salary. These often include:
Housing Allowance: A substantial stipend to cover rent.
Transportation Allowance: For car fuel or other commute costs.
Annual Flight Tickets: Return tickets to your home country for you and sometimes your family.
Health Insurance: Comprehensive medical coverage for you and your dependents.
Education Allowance: For your children's schooling in Dubai's numerous international schools.
Strategic Global Hub: Dubai is a nexus for finance, trade, tourism, logistics, and technology. Working here provides unparalleled exposure to international business practices and a multicultural professional network.
Safety and Stability: The UAE is consistently ranked as one of the safest countries in the world, with a low crime rate and a stable political environment.
Unmatched Lifestyle: From pristine beaches and world-class restaurants to desert safaris and iconic events, Dubai offers a lifestyle that is hard to match. It's a melting pot of cultures, making it easy for expats to feel at home.
Career Growth: The fast-paced economy and constant development of new projects create abundant opportunities for rapid career advancement, often faster than in more mature markets.
The Dubai Job Market: Key Industries and In-Demand Roles
Dubai's economy is diversifying rapidly, moving beyond its oil-based roots. The key sectors driving employment are:
1. Tourism, Hospitality, and Retail:
As a global tourism magnet, this sector is perpetually booming. Home to the Burj Khalifa, the Dubai Mall, and countless luxury hotels and resorts, opportunities are vast.
In-Demand Roles: Hotel Managers, F&B Directors, Chefs, Marketing Executives, Sales Managers, Retail Buyers, Store Managers, Customer Experience Specialists, Event Planners.
2. Construction, Real Estate, and Infrastructure:
With Expo 2020 behind it, Dubai continues its relentless development with projects like Dubai Creek Harbour, Mohammed Bin Rashid City, and a sustained focus on luxury properties and smart city infrastructure.
In-Demand Roles: Project Managers, Civil Engineers, Architects, Quantity Surveyors, Urban Planners, Real Estate Brokers, Property Consultants, Facility Managers.
3. Finance and Banking:
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C) is a leading financial hub for the Middle East, Africa, and South Asia (MEASA) region, hosting hundreds of financial institutions, banks, and fintech companies.
In-Demand Roles: Relationship Managers, Financial Analysts, Investment Bankers, Risk & Compliance Officers, Fintech Specialists, Accountants, Auditors.
